Dress code

Participants must wear swimwear and secure footwear such as trainers or water shoes. Neoprene suits and helmets are provided for every canyoning bagni di lucca tour.

Bags & security

Avoid bringing valuables to the Lima River as there is no storage on the water. Use provided lockers at the operator base for personal belongings during your canyoning bagni di lucca session.

Photography

Waterproof cameras or action cams with chest mounts are recommended for capturing canyoning bagni di lucca footage. Many operators include souvenir photo services in your canyoning bagni di lucca tickets.

Accessibility

Navigating the rocky terrain of the Lima River requires moderate physical fitness. Canyoning bagni di lucca is not suitable for those with mobility impairments due to uneven riverbeds and climbing sections.

Canyoning Bagni di Lucca Adventure

The Lima River cuts through the Apennine foothills above Bagni di Lucca with a precision that took ten thousand years. Its channel narrows into gorges where vertical limestone walls rise four storeys high, polished smooth by seasonal floods.

Read more

Canyoning Bagni di Lucca emerged in the early 2000s when local mountain guides mapped a series of descents through these natural corridors, identifying sections where the riverbed drops in clean cascades between pools deep enough to absorb a ten-metre jump. The sport takes its Italian name, torrentismo, from torrente—the word for a mountain stream that swells fast and recedes faster.

Today the Lima corridor is recognised as one of Tuscany's premier technical descents. The river runs year-round, but spring snowmelt from the Apuan Alps raises water levels to their most dramatic between April and June, when the current accelerates through chutes barely wide enough for a climber's span. By August the flow gentles, exposing gravel bars and rock ledges that serve as natural rest points. Most guided routes begin upstream near the hamlet of Montefegatesi, where the gorge tightens and the river enters a sequence of sculpted basins separated by natural slides—smooth stone ramps worn concave by centuries of erosion. Participants abseil into the upper canyon, then follow the water downstream through a series of obstacles: boulder jams that require lateral traverses, plunge pools reached only by controlled drops, and narrow flumes where the current funnels between house-sized slabs.

The geology is Macigno sandstone overlaid with Scaglia limestone, a combination that resists fracture while yielding to water. Fossils—ammonites and belemnites from the Cretaceous seabed—appear in cross-section along the canyon walls, visible to anyone rappelling past. The river's temperature holds steady near twelve degrees Celsius even in summer, cold enough to require a wetsuit for any descent longer than two hours. Canyoning adventure Bagni di Lucca routes are graded by technical demand: beginner itineraries involve minimal rope work and optional jumps no higher than four metres, while advanced descents require multi-pitch abseils and navigation through submerged passages. All routes exit near the thermal baths of Bagni di Lucca proper, where nineteenth-century spa architecture now shares the valley floor with modern climbing outfitters. The river remains free to access; guided tours include equipment, instruction, and shuttle transport to the entry point nine kilometres upstream.

What a Canyoning Bagni Di Lucca tour day looks like

A step-by-step walkthrough of Canyoning Bagni Di Lucca tickets — what you'll see, how long each stage takes, and the details that matter.

You meet your guide at the Lima River access point shortly after nine, when morning light begins to reach the canyon floor. Wetsuits, helmets, and harnesses are distributed on the gravel bar; the guide checks each buckle twice.

The group walks upstream along a footpath that parallels the river, then descends a fixed ladder into the gorge proper. The first abseil is twelve metres, rope threaded through a steel anchor bolted into the limestone. You lean back over the edge, feet against wet rock, and descend in controlled drops until the pool receives you.

The water is cold enough to tighten your breath. You swim forward to clear the landing zone for the next person, then wade through knee-deep current toward the first natural slide—a smooth chute angled thirty degrees, polished to a dull sheen. You sit, push off, and accelerate through a blur of stone and spray before the pool at the base slows you. Three more cascades follow in quick succession, each requiring a short swim between them. At the midpoint the canyon widens; you pause on a boulder ledge to drink water and adjust your helmet strap.

The final descent is a twenty-metre abseil down a waterfall face, spray soaking your gloves as you feed rope through the device. You touch down in the exit pool, unclip, and swim toward daylight. The shuttle van waits two hundred metres downstream, parked near the old spa quarter.
